Diverse(ish): Intersectionality

Thursday 04 February 2021, 5:30pm - 7pm

Online - Zoom
About this event

Come to this month's anti-racism forum Diverse(ish) as part of LGBT+ History Month where the discussion will focus on intersectionality. We will be exploring the intersections of identity in race and religion alongside identifying as lgbt+. There will also be space to discuss your experiences as being an LGBT+ student or staff member at Queen Mary and what the University could do to be a more inclusive environment.
